Center Stage for Millie Bobby Brown

November 10, 2025: Last weekend, Millie Bobby Brown stepped into the limelight at the FYC (For Your Consideration) event in Los Angeles for Stranger Things, held at the Netflix Tudum Theater. The event, designed to drum up awards buzz for the upcoming final season, saw Brown and her co-stars in full promotional mode, walking the red carpet and engaging with fans and media.
